Skip to main content

Firebase Cloud Messaging Push Notification To Web

สวัสดีครับ ในบทความวันนี้จะเป็นการแนะนำ การส่ง Push Notification ไปยัง Web Browser ด้วย Cloud Messaging ใน Firebase กันครับ

มาเริ่มกันเลย ก่อนอื่นเราต้องไปสร้าง Project ที่ Firebase Console กันก่อนครับ
https://console.firebase.google.com

Read More

Upload Image File To Base64 String And Resize Image

สวัสดีครับ กลับมาพบกันอีกแล้ว

วันนี้เรามีเทคนิค ง่าย ๆ  ในการ อัพโหลดรูปภาพ เป็น ข้อมูล Base64 String และ Resize Image Thumbnail มาฝากกันครับ

โดยข้อมูล base64 นี้จะเป็นข้อความ สามารถเก็บลง Database ได้เลย ทำให้ไม่ต้องเก็บเป็นไฟล์รูปจริงครับ
แต่มีข้อเสียคือ หากรูปมีจำนวนมาก หรือ รูปมีขนาดใหญ่ จะทำให้ Database ของเราใช้พื้นที่มากขึ้นครับ

มาเริ่มกันเลย ตัวอย่างในบทความนี้จะใช้ Angular นะครับ สำหรับเพื่อน ๆ ที่เขียนด้วยภาษา หรือ เครื่องมือ อื่น ๆ สามารถนำไปประยุกต์ใช้งานได้เลยครับ

Read More

สร้าง Barcode ด้วย JsBarcode

สวัสดีครับ ในบทความนี้ ทางผู้เขียนจะขอแนะนำ Library สำหรับสร้าง Barcode แบบง่าย ๆ กันครับ นั่นก็คือ JsBarcode ซึ่งเป็น Javascript ใช้งานได้ง่ายครับ ลองไปดูที่เว็บผู้พัฒนากันก่อนคร้ับ

https://lindell.me/JsBarcode/

สำหรับมือใหม่ที่ดูแล้วไม่รู้จะนำไปใช้งานยังไง สามารถทำตามบทความนี้ได้เลยครับ
Read More

FullCalendar Integrate With Google Calendar API

สวัสดีครับ กลับมาพบกันอีกครั้งในบทความนี้จะขอแนะนำ การใช้งาน Fullcalendar โดยครั้งนี้จะเป็นการเชื่อมต่อกับ Google Calendar Api สำหรับนำข้อมูลที่บันทึกใน Google Calendar มาแสดงใน Fullcalendar ของเราครับ
Read More

สร้าง Charts แบบสวย ๆ ด้วย Echarts Javascript Library

สวัสดีครับ ในบทความนี้ เราจะมาแนะนำ Java script Library อีกตัว ไว้เป็นทางเลือก สำหรับ การสร้าง รายงานในรูปแบบกราฟ ครับ
ซึ่ง Library ที่จะแนะนำในที่นี้ มีชื่อ ว่า  Echarts สามารถดูตัวอย่าง เต็ม ๆ ได้ที่

https://ecomfe.github.io/echarts-doc/public/en/index.html

Read More

แสดง ip ผู้เข้าชม Website ด้วย ipstack.com

ในบทความนี้ เราจะมาแนะนำการ แสดง ข้อมูล ip ผู้เข้าชม Website ด้วย ipstack.com กันครับ

ipstack.com คืออะไร

ipstack คือ Web Api ที่ให้บริการในการตรวจสอบ ข้อมูลผู้เข้าชม Web Site ของเรา โดยสามารถเก็บข้อมูลพื้นฐาน เช่น เลข IP,  ประเทศ (Country) ,ตำแหน่งที่ตั้ง (Latitude,Longitude) ,  สกุลเงิน (Currency) , เขตเวลา (Time Zone) เป็นต้น

Read More

Export ข้อมูลอย่างง่ายด้วย TableExport.js Javascript Library

สวัสดีครับ ในบทความนี้เราจะมาแนะนำการใช้งาน TableExport.js ซึ่งเป็น Javascript Library สำหรับ Export ข้อมูลรองรับการ Export ข้อมูลจาก Html Table ไปเป็นไฟล์ Excel , Csv หรือ ไฟล์ text
การใช้งานสามารถดูตัวอย่างเพิ่มเติมจากเว็บไซต์ผู้พัฒนาได้ที่
https://tableexport.v4.travismclarke.com/#tableexport

Read More

สร้าง ปฏิทินตารางเวลา ด้วย FullCalendar Scheduler Javascript Library

สวัสดีครับ ในบทความนี้ เราจะมาแนะนำการใช้งาน Fullcalendar Scheduler ซึ่งเป็น Javascript Library สำหรับ จัดการข้อมูลตารางเวลา สามารถ แสดงเหตุการณ์ในแต่ละช่วงเวลาของวันได้  ซึ่งสามารถนำไปประยุกต์ใช้งานได้ หลายรูปแบบ เช่น แสดงช่วงเวลาการใช้ห้องประชุม เป็นต้น

สามารถดูตัวอย่างการใช้งานได้ที่  Fullcalendar Scheduler

Read More